Question 1186685: Adam wants to save $43,000.00 for a down payment on a home. How much will he need to invest in an account with 8% APR, compounding daily, in order to reach his goal in 7 years? Round the answer to the nearest cent. Answer by Boreal(15235) (Show Source):
You can put this solution on YOUR website! 43000=m(1+(0.08/365)^2555, where the 2555 is the number of days in 7 years.
43000=m (1.751) round at end, however.
43000/1.751=$24563.50
